SoMax Circular Solutions was named the grand winner of the Distilled Spirits Council’s “Innovation Showcase” competition during the awards luncheon at the 2022 DISCUS Annual Conference in New Orleans.

SoMax Founder and CEO Dan Spracklin presented the company’s innovative resource recovery technology during the Shark Tank-style competition. The technology, which uses hydrothermal carbonization, can help distilleries convert distilling byproducts, including spent grains, into renewable energy, eliminating disposal cost while also improving the environment.

The second place winner was Bacardi, presented by Bacardi Senior Packaging Developer Adrien Fletcher, for the spirits company’s development and execution of new packaging that eliminates all single use plastic in its secondary packaging, including plastic windows, thermoforms and neckers. This is part of the company’s commitment of removing 100 percent of all single-use plastic from its gift packs and point-of-sale materials by the end of 2023.

Third place was awarded to Tapi Group for its new bottle closure that includes a bio-compostable case containing a seed inside that consumers can plant, giving the topper a second life.  The innovation engages the consumer in advancing sustainability and features a wide variety of seeds that can be planted indoors or outside.

Six finalists were selected to compete in the Innovation Showcase sponsored by DISCUS partner member The Spearhead Group at this year’s conference.  The finalists were chosen out of more than 30 submissions in categories spanning from spirits packaging, technology, supply chain, sustainability, marketing, structure, responsibility and product development.

Each contestant had 15 minutes to present their innovation in front of a panel of judges who scored the innovation based on its concept, value, scalability and demonstrated impact.

The judges were Jason Drook, VP Consumer & Industrial Business at CIA; Mariana Ruiz, Associate Director Client Services, NielsenIQ and Mark Gillespie, Host/Executive Producer of WhiskyCast.  Lana Toler, Marketing & Innovation Manager for The Spearhead Group, moderated the event.

The first, second and third place winners receive prize packages ranging in value from $5,000 to $20,000 including a $10,000 cash prize for the showcase winner.

Other finalists included: Endless West; Two Trees Distilling Co; and Vigate.
